My name is Ron and I have fished since 1954. I have carp fished since around 1959 after reading "Still Water Angling". Up until 1967, my biggest ever English carp weighed 9 lbs 15 1/2oz.
From 1968 until 1975 I fished for carp intensively and was a member of the BCSG and resident in South Africa. There I stayed until 1994. I caught thousands of carp up to a few that went over 50 lbs.
I returned to the UK in 1994 and spent most of my life as an all round anglers catching trout on the fly, to roach on the stick float. I caught lots of double figure barbel from the Trent.
Earlier this year I decided to return to serious carp fishing, just to see if I could still do it.
I surprised myself and caught several 20s in addition to my UK PB of 271/2 lbs which holds a lake record for a 5 acre North Lincs lake.
I look forward to some interesting debates

My name is Peter, I live near Rotterdam and I have been chasing carp for about 25 years now.In Holland carp fishing is becoming more and more popular and therefore it is very busy on most of the smaller lakes and canals. For that reason,I decided to try and catch carp on the bigger rivers in Holland like Hollands Diep,Haringvliet and the Biesbosch-region. It is the same river where Dave Thorpe caught the Dutch record carp many many years ago. A very large riversystem that makes you feel real tiny.....This is my second year on these rivers,and I must say that it has put a sort of a spell on me I am not catching a lot of fish,but each and every fish I manage to catch overthere is very special to me.
Hopefully I will get to know some nice fishing-colleagues on this forum to share my passion with.
